The art that emerged in the mountains of Kurdistan has carried deep meaning and importance in the hearts of peoples, especially the Kurdish people, for decades. The music created by the freedom guerrillas touches people’s lives and remains on their tongues for years.

One of the groups that has gained a place in people’s hearts through its art is Awazê Çiya. As they prepare to release their new album, members of Awazê Çiya spoke to ANF.

Tekoşîn Cûdî, one of the group members, gave details about the new album and said: “After our project, titled ‘Destana PKK,’ we are preparing an album that we want to dedicate to our people and to everyone who is part of the freedom struggle and who works to grow this great and comprehensive resistance.

We work with great hope, will, and belief in our free mountain areas under all circumstances. By participating in this effort, we also join the resistance, we strengthen it, and within this rich ocean, we create the melody of a new life. We want to be the voice, the color, and the art of our people.”

The artist added: “We want to be comrades of socialist, democratic, and especially in this era, those who wage the freedom struggle and dedicate themselves to it. That is why we are preparing a new album. The content of our album is based on our values, the martyrs of resistance, the spiritual meaning the martyrs shared with us, and the legacy our comrades left behind. We want to share these values through art and music.

On this basis, we dedicate this album especially to the leader of this era, the pioneer of freedom, the leader of a democratic and free society, and the fighter for socialism, Leader Apo. We hope our album reaches the hearts of its listeners. Of course, there may be criticisms, positive or negative feedback. But art is the language of expression.

Art is amplifying the meaning of history. Its most beautiful aspect is leaving something for humanity. During this period, we also want to make the lived history and spirit permanent in history so that our people, especially our youth, continue their lives in their own language, with their own art and culture. Our album includes Dimilkî, Soranî, and Kurmancî dialects. The works in this album mostly consist of pieces by Awazê Çiya. We released and shared several albums before this one, and this will continue. We will soon share our new album.”

The artist continued: “We want to share the struggle, the resistance, the values, freedom, the new society, the socialist and democratic society with our people through art and production. We must narrate the lived history and the resistance through the language of art, make it a part of history, and build our future upon it. Everyone must take responsibility for this. Because struggle, war, and resistance cannot exist without art. Art is the historical identity.”

A new album to be released

Another member of the Awazê Çiya group, Seyît Riza Sulbus, said the following about the new album: “We have been working on this album for a while. After the ‘Destana PKK’ project, we went through a period where artistic production was very limited. After some preparations, this work began. Our album consists of 10 songs. The album mainly focuses on our martyred comrades. It also expresses the connection between the guerrillas and the people, what is valuable to them, and the feelings and thoughts they carry in their hearts.

The leadership struggle also has a strong place in the songs. In this period, Leader Apo plays a very active role. This is a great honor for us. Therefore, we dedicate our album to Leader Apo, our people, and all our comrades fighting in various areas.”

Sulbus added: “The album was produced at the Martyr Zerdeşt Art Workshop. This workshop has long been an important center for guerrilla art in the mountains. The entire team involved in this work and the members of Awazê Çiya put in intense effort. Our institutions also provided strong support. On behalf of the Music Commune, the Awazê Çiya group, and the Martyr Zerdeşt Art Workshop, we thank all our friends. We hope this album will reach the hearts of our comrades and our people. With great excitement, we will soon release our album and deliver it to our people.”
